There are several types of roofing materials available for use in Mount Pleasant. These include asphalt shingle roofs, metal roofs, tile roofs, and flat roofs made of rubber or PVC membranes. Asphalt shingle roofs are typically composed of multiple layers that overlap each other to create a durable barrier against water damage; they come in many colors and styles that can complement any home’s design aesthetic. Metal roofs provide an additional level of protection against extreme weather conditions; they also tend to last longer than other materials when properly installed. Tile roofs offer unique textures and color options but require more maintenance than some other materials; they’re best suited for areas with milder climates where debris isn’t likely to accumulate on the surface over time. Flat rubber or PVC membrane-based systems offer an efficient solution for waterproofing large buildings without sacrificing style; their simple construction allows them to be easily customized based on the needs of any given project.

Weather and Climate Impact on Residential Roofing

When it comes to residential roofing in Mount Pleasant, the weather and climate conditions can have a significant impact. With temperatures that range from hot summers to cold winters, extreme weather events like hail storms are not uncommon. This means that homeowners need to be aware of the potential damage caused by these weather patterns and how they can affect their roofing system.
The effects of strong winds on a home’s roof can be particularly damaging during winter months. Heavy snowfall combined with powerful gusts can lead to broken shingles or tiles as well as ice dams which may prevent melting snow from draining properly off the roof. The accumulation of water could cause major issues such as leaks or even flooding if left unchecked for too long. Homeowners should also consider additional insulation when installing new roofs to reduce energy costs throughout all four seasons.
Rainfall is another factor that needs consideration when it comes to residential roofing in Mount Pleasant. Intense thunderstorms with high levels of rain are common during summer months and this large amount of moisture hitting your rooftop over an extended period could potentially damage flashing around vents or skylights if not installed correctly initially or maintained regularly afterwards. Waterproof membranes should also be applied beneath any type of tile, slate or metal roof covering for extra protection against rainfall penetration into your attic space below.

Inspection for Attic Insulation in Mount Pleasant

Carrying out a comprehensive inspection of attic insulation in Mount Pleasant is essential for any roofing project. It helps to identify the existing insulation materials and its level of efficiency. It also helps ascertain whether or not additional insulation should be added to maximize energy savings.
An experienced roofer will perform an assessment on the condition of your home’s attic space, including evaluating access points and ventilation needs. They’ll check for gaps between joists where air can escape, evaluate overall thickness and type of existing insulation materials present as well as check around windows and doors for air leaks. If necessary they may use specialized equipment such as thermal imaging cameras to inspect further into walls cavities or attics that are difficult to reach.
After a thorough inspection is complete a professional contractor will provide recommendations on how best to improve energy efficiency by adding more insulation if required or replacing old materials with newer ones that have higher R-values (a measure used in determining resistance). The contractor might suggest increasing ventilation too if necessary – this could involve adding extra soffit vents which allow outside air flow into the attic space; helping keep temperatures consistent year round regardless of weather conditions outside.

Optimizing Ventilation to Protect Your Home’s Roofing

The roof of a home is essential in providing protection from the elements. In Mount Pleasant, it’s important to ensure that your roofing is properly ventilated in order to maintain its integrity and protect against damage from extreme weather. Ventilation helps reduce the buildup of heat within an attic space or other enclosed area, while also preventing condensation on surfaces that can lead to rot and decay over time.
When it comes to optimizing ventilation for roofing purposes, there are several key steps you should take. Start by ensuring that your home has adequate soffit vents near the eaves of your roof; these allow air flow into the attic space while allowing moisture-laden air to escape as well. Install ridge vents along the peak of your roof; this will provide additional airflow without compromising insulation or blocking rainfall runoff pathways. Be sure all exhaust fans are working properly so they don’t trap hot air inside rather than releasing it outside as intended.
For added protection against water infiltration during heavy rains or melting snowfall periods, installing flashing around any protrusions like chimneys or skylights is crucial; flashing should extend at least four inches up from any such structure and overlap with existing shingle layers wherever possible. This provides a further barrier between outdoor precipitation and interior spaces where humidity could cause serious structural issues if not prevented through proper waterproofing methods like this one.
